
UAS Aerochute Systems is an Australian company with 20 years experience in the manufacture of Powered Parachutes, Parachute Recovery Systems for Unmanned Aircraft application, and the Aerochute Unmanned Systems.
The UAS airframe and powerplant will be fully customisable to mission requirements. The Aerochute Unmanned Systems can accommodate various canopy designs to fit mission specific payload platforms currently to a maximum useful payload weight of 300 Kilograms. The Unmanned Aerochute Systems (UAS) is a fully autonomous platform with a wide range of mission capabilities.
Typical missions are:
-Airborne precision guided cargo delivery
-Surveilance
-Humanitarian food and medical delivery
-Covert operations
The Aerochute Unmanned Systems can be operated by an onboard pilot, by remote control from the ground, or fully autonomous via Ground Control Station with range up 50 Kilometres. Range can also greatly increase with optional SATCOM module.
The Aerochute Unmanned Systems can also be configured as a strap-on module for airborne cargo deployment which greatly increases the systems flexibilty in cargo deployments. The onboard GPS based autopilot and inertial navigation system features real time mission datalink, and remote command and control capability by an operator using Ground Control Station (GCS). The GCS allows the operator to monitor the UAS mission as well as changing mission parameters in real time. With optional Satellite Communication datalink, the UAS can be operated from anywhere in the world.
